Simple Steps To Help You Better Understand Facebook Marketing

You may already use Facebook to communicate with friends and family, but you can also use it to communicate with your business audience. Social media sites are very popular because people love the communication. Use this to your advantage by using Facebook to showcase your business.

Reply to everything written about your company, be it on your page’s wall or elsewhere on Facebook. It is important to monitor your wall daily and to check out @ messages for your brand as well. Make sure to reply to all inquiries or complaints.

One method for generating interest in your business is by having a giveaway. Try getting your customers to ‘like’ your site by giving them something for free. Make a big announcement of winner names on your page, and keep doing that whenever you want more subscribers.

Facebook ads are a great place to start. Your products or service will only receive so much promotion from your normal postings. To reach more into your specific channel, you should buy some ads on Facebook. They are inexpensive, and can make a big difference.

You must have an attention-getting page so that your page is set apart from the rest. You can accomplish this by including a lot of photos and making it very colorful. This will attract more users.

Consider creating a Facebook group rather than just a page. A Facebook group allows users to have their own community. Allow your subscribers to post content on your Facebook page.

Use Facebook Offers to share coupon codes or organize contests for your subscribers. All that you must do is give them the offer and then set up a Promo Post on the wall of your Facebook page. If it’s a good offer, it can be promoted to non-fans.

You need a good fan base when you are using Facebook as a marketing strategy. Save your major marketing investments for after you have built a base of a few thousand Facebook fans. If you have that may fans, you can see some real success.

Giveaways are very helpful in marketing. Give away something to a small group of your customers willing to be on the mailing list or those who give your Facebook page a “like.” This will help you to communicate more often with potential clients.

A great way to boost conversion of visitors to followers is by hiding content from those who are not yet fans. If your Facebook page has a hidden area that can only be seen by followers, you can motivate more visitors to convert to followers. Exercise good judgement in the amount of content you provide behind a fans-only area, because it will impact your SEO.

Keep your followers updated regularly on Facebook. Opt for quality posts over quantity. You want to save the information and put it out in an attractive way. That will make it more effective and likely to be remembered.

Do not turn off the comment function on your Facebook page. This will show that you are interested in what people have to say at all times.

Determine why you are creating a Facebook page in the first place. Never be a Facebook user for no reason. Are you creating it to get a message to your customers? Or do you have one so your customers are able to contact you? Utilizing Facebook to increase sales is something different than simply using it to keep fans interested.

It is essential that you nurture your relationship with others who you are interacting with on Facebook. Just as you would with in-person conversations, building good relationships on Facebook will help your sales in the long run. One way to build an on-going relationship is to keep your content fresh and easy to understand. Do not forget to provide rewards through discounts and promotions to your loyal customers.

Do your best to keep up with all comments made on your page. This means to respond to inbox messages and those left on the main page. This may take some time, but the personal touch will be appreciated.
